Lentswe, Jouberton - The Lulu Chao Foundation presented a youth program on July 2 at Liquid Centre to help the youth stand strong in these challenging times.
The message brought by Rev MP Moholo was for them to focus on their education to they can seize opportunities. “Life is very difficult, and they need to navigate and make sure they change their ways and be the best persons they can be,’’ he said.

The LFC program is an ongoing program, where young people get together every Wednesday at 15:00 to discuss the future. “We are planning events for international Mandela Day to contribute to the society. We are hopeful for donations from the business community who wants to take hands with LFC,’’ said Luluy Chao.
